Chalmit Lighting News Room

Lighting for Safety in Hazardous Areas

Chalmit Lighting - safety lighting, illuminaires and emergency lighting Chalmit Lighting is committed to producing offshore (oil and gas exploration), onshore, marine and industrial lighting products that give reliable performance in extreme environments.

A leading supplier to the hazardous area market, the company manufactures fluorescent and HID luminaires with international certification to meet every need. These approvals cover hazardous area classification in accordance with the ATEX directive, CSA, CEPEL (Brazil) and GOST R (Russia). The company also has certification for lighting products under the IEC Ex scheme. In addition, many of the luminaires in the Chalmit range have high levels of IP protection and are Lloyds/DNV vibration and DTS-1 deluge tested.

The company also produces an extensive range of specialised industrial luminaires, constructed to the same high specification as the Ex equipment.

Development and production are supported by in depth quality assurance systems and approvals including ISO9000:2001. Research is continuous and the company has close associations with leading universities for the commercialisation of new technology to bring higher levels of lighting safety, reliability and efficiency. Free software, Chalmlite™, is available to assist in the selection of the correct lighting and determining the optimal lighting density for efficient working.

As a member of Hubbell Electrical Products, a division of Hubbell Inc., the company can offer a global range of both IEC & NEC products suitable for hazardous area lighting and apparatus installations. Chalmit Lighting has a number of strategically placed sales and technical support offices worldwide in Europe, the Middle East, S.E. Asia and China.
